This prospective, multicenter, randomized, controlled, open-label clinical study has a target enrollment of 240 subjects. It will explore whether STEMI patients transferred to a PCI center following thrombolytic therapy and expected to have stent implantation might benefit from an alternative treatment strategy and the use of new technologies designed to improve myocardial protection throughout the medical care process.
Eligible patients with STEMI who meet the Inclusion/Exclusion Criteria will receive thrombolytic therapy, and then be transferred to the PCI center for coronary angiography (CAG). Patients having a target vessel with TIMI grade 3 flow as shown by CAG, and and ≥ 50% angiographic stenosis after thrombus aspiration, will be randomized in a 1:1 ratio to either an immediate stenting group or a deferred stenting group. Patients assigned to the immediate stenting group will undergo appropriate stent implantation based on characteristics of the lesions. Patients assigned to the deferred stenting group will be sent back to the ward after PCI to receive standard anticoagulant and antiplatelet therapies, and the CAG will be repeated 5 to 7 days after initial intervention, followed by treatment with stent implantation. All subjects will be recorded postoperative microcirculation perfusion and ST-segment drop of electrocardiogram and followed up by telephone or in the clinic at 1, 6, and 12 months after discharge from the hospital to obtain information including their general condition, chief complaints or discomforts, details of taking their oral medications, recent relevant test results, and to evaluate the primary endpoint, secondary endpoints.
